Job description

SUMMARY

The HVAC Apprentice/Journeyperson holds a valid Certificate of Qualification issued by the province in which the work is performed. The incumbent is responsible for operating facility systems, performing preventative and corrective maintenance, routine services on facility mechanical and other systems for the assigned facility within the limits of company policy and trade certification. The HVAC Journeyperson is also responsible for performing work in accordance with established processes and practices and for complying with internal and external requirements including but not limited to environmental, health and safety, security and fire protection.

KEY D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ES

Installation & Troubleshooting

  • Installs air conditioning, heating, and related equipment and components.
  • Overhauls and services air conditioning, heating units and systems.
  • Repairs, replaces and adjusts worn or broken parts HVAC equipment.
  • Repairs and adjusts valves, piping connections, fittings, and couplings.
  • Diagnoses and troubleshoots problems with heating and air conditioning units and systems.
  • Installs motors, thermostats, and humidistats.
